A Rajshahi University associate professor has been prohibited from taking part in any kinds of administrative and examination related activities for 10 years after he was found guilty of plagiarism. The university also served show-cause notice on accounting and information system professor Muhammad Abdul Mazed Chowdhury on allegation of taking bribe from a jobseeker assuring him of job. The university also suspended temporarily a lecturer of accounting and information systems Mamun Hossain for losing examination papers…
